    I had a chance to talk to the chairman of the 4920 Group at the South Devon 50th gala. In his opinion, 3803 would probably be their next overhaul, because it needed relatively little to achieve a running engine again. Towing 5 coaches around on the branch hadn't worn it out much, apparently! 4920 (and 3205) were another matter entirely, or so we were told. We were also told that 3803 might even be started on in the very short term, as it looked like the boiler needed far less work than 1420's!

    I'm always surprised that no one has had a crack at designing a narrowed down, more gauge friendly set of cylinders for the Halls to increase their route availability.

    For a bit of variety for the Mainline operators and could help bump a couple of locos up the restoration queue. Being pragmatic, with the age of the locos i can only see it as a matter of time before more and more need new cylinders cast so it could be a chance to get ahead of the curve. In realistic terms i can't see it being the huge outlay that it would have been 10-15 years ago with the use of Poly patterns, and it should be straightforward compared to the work that the P2 group have done.

    My understanding is that the issue with GWR outside cylinder locos is not just the maximum width, but where it is - low down, specifically at platform height. As far as I can tell (maybe @Jimc can enlighten us further) the GWR accepted a tighter gap between the loading gauge and structure gauge (essentially the loading gauge is how big the "thing" is; and the structure gauge is how big the "hole" is that you are trying to fit that "thing" through). In modern usage, it seems to be the structure gauge which is tightening up (i.e. primarily rails moving tighter to platforms in order to reduce the risk of a passenger falling between platform edge and a train).

    As for redesigning the cylinders: there is a description here of how that was done on 6023. A number of measures taken, but a significant one was reducing cylinder diameter. There is an obvious primary issue with doing that, which is getting the new design accepted by a vehicle acceptance body. (On 6023 it was thinner material; more, but thinner, studs holding the cylinder ends on; and a different material for the casting - quite a significant change). The second issue is that whereas for a King, reducing the cylinder size might take a nominal 8P down to a still useful 7P; doing the same on a Class 5 potentially starts to lead towards a loco that is not powerful enough to haul viable loads on the mainline.

    I suspect the physical casting itself is small beer by time you have got past those considerations.
